Embracing Quantum Transition: Unlocking the Future of Technology

June 7, 20233 Mins Read

In the vast realm of science and technology, a phenomenon promises to revolutionize our understanding and capabilities. Welcome to the era of the quantum transition, where the principles of quantum mechanics take center stage. This exciting frontier holds the potential to transform fields such as computing, cryptography, and communication, paving the way for a new era of unprecedented advancements.

Quantum Transition
At the heart of the quantum transition lies the remarkable power of quantum computers. Unlike classical computers that rely on bits, quantum computers harness the properties of quantum bits, or qubits, which can exist in multiple states simultaneously. This allows quantum computers to perform complex calculations with astounding speed and efficiency, solving problems that are currently beyond the reach of classical computing.

The need for robust security measures has become paramount in an increasingly interconnected world. Enter quantum cryptography, a field that utilizes the fundamental principles of quantum mechanics to secure information transmission. By exploiting the inherent properties of qubits, such as entanglement and superposition, quantum cryptography ensures that communication channels remain invulnerable to eavesdropping, guaranteeing unprecedented levels of security and privacy.

Quantum transition extends its reach beyond computing and cryptography. Quantum sensors, which exploit the delicacy and sensitivity of quantum systems, provide remarkable precision in measurement and detection. These sensors have the potential to revolutionize fields like navigation, imaging, and medical diagnostics, offering unparalleled accuracy and opening new avenues for scientific exploration and technological innovation.

While the potential of the quantum transition is vast, it is not without challenges. The delicate nature of quantum systems makes them susceptible to decoherence and errors, demanding significant advancements in error correction and fault-tolerant design. Moreover, the practical realization of large-scale quantum computers and widespread implementation of quantum technologies require substantial investments in research and infrastructure.

Nevertheless, the quantum transition holds tremendous promise. Governments, research institutions, and tech companies worldwide are actively investing in quantum research and development, propelling the field forward. As we continue to unlock the mysteries of the quantum world, we can anticipate breakthroughs that will reshape our technological landscape, drive innovation, and solve complex problems that have long evaded us.

The quantum transition signifies a remarkable leap forward in understanding and utilising quantum phenomena. Quantum computing, cryptography, and sensing technologies have the potential to revolutionize our world, enabling us to tackle challenges that were once considered insurmountable. Embracing this quantum future will require collaboration, investment, and an insatiable thirst for knowledge. As we embark on this thrilling journey, the possibilities are limitless, and the rewards immeasurable.
